Output 59fb28a450f9576d7ee45adac88f631991a4ac20546cb227bb862cd2a956a3c0:1

value
18629213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776b234f74cd3adf55aa08d5603ab1790855edbc OP_EQUAL
address
3CaSgSo2fJbwJk4HSKW2V6gxePxBpMKYs7
transaction
59fb28a450f9576d7ee45adac88f631991a4ac20546cb227bb862cd2a956a3c0
spent
true